What is MIGO Opportunities Trust Altman Z2-Score?

Altman Z2-Score, also known as Z"-Score, is used to predict the likelihood that a non-manufacturing company (excluding property/financial company) will face bankruptcy within a two-year period.

Altman Z2-Score does not apply to banks and insurance companies.

MIGO Opportunities Trust PLC operates as an investment management company. Its principal activity is to carry on business as an investment trust. The objective of the company is to outperform Sterling three month SONIA plus 2% over the longer term, principally through exploiting inefficiencies in the pricing of closed-end funds. It has a presence in the UK, Asia Pacific, Europe, India, North America, Japan, Africa, and Other Countries. The company also invests in any class of security issued by investment funds including, without limitation, equity, debt, warrants, or other convertible securities.
